Equivalent des BPL de Delphi
Salut
Je viens du monde de Delphi et je voudrais faire un logiciel avec des modules codés dans des paquets dynamiques (packages).
J'ai pensé dans un premier temps utiliser des dll, mais j'ai lu que c'était impossible d’intégrer des fiches dans les dll qui puissent interagir avec l'application maître (appelante).
J'aimerais donc savoir s'il n'y a pas d'équivalent des bpl de Delphi dans Lazarus.
J'ai bien essayé avec les lpk mais j'ai constaté que Lazarus les intègre directement dans l'exe.
Merci de vos apports.
Je suis en Lazarus 1.0.8 et Windows 8.
Réduire la taille de l'exe
En fait je suis en train de faire un erp.
Et les module vont être nombreux ...
Mon objectif est de pouvoir diminuer la taille de l'exe et de pouvoir faire des mises à jour ciblées de mon logiciel et ainsi avoir un système de plugins performants.
Je n'hésiterais pas à utiliser des dll mais je ne sais pas comment intégrer des fiches dans les dll qui interagissent avec le logiciel maître.
Compilation optionnelle? Ant?
Il est vrai que je ne suis pas très avancé en POO pour utiliser les interfaces...
La solution Ant m'intéresse (je ne connaissais pas) mais selon mes recherches
dans Google, c'est utilisé avec Eclipse ou Netbeans pour le développement Java.
Si ça peut s'utiliser avec lazarus, puis-je avoir des liens de tutos?